3 Year Undergraduate Programs
How? Get a jump start on your BGSU degree by completing requirements while you are still in high school or prior to enrolling at BGSU. Before enrolling as a new freshman at BGSU, earn at least 30 credit hours that count toward one of the BGSU majors students can complete in three years. You can earn the 30 hours through the following programs:
- PSEO (Post Secondary Enrollment Options)
- AP (Advanced Placement)
- Dual Enrollment courses
- IB (International Baccalaureate: subject exams similar to AP)
- CLEP (College Level Examination Program) *Review of military training and coursework
- Transfer coursework from a regionally accredited institution of higher education
- Credit by examination

To keep in mind. Students can also accelerate time to degree completion by taking courses in the summer. Summer enrollment may make it easier to accomplish multiple majors, complete a minor, change majors, or participate in study abroad, undergraduate research, or internships, practicums, and coops. A BGSU advisor can help you sort through the options that are best for you.
